April 12, 2021 – Millikin University will present the 5th annual Civic Discourse Week April 12-16, 2021. In the midst of an increasingly diverse array of perspectives, civic discourse helps demonstrate shared responsibility to one another, our commitment to our systems, and the willingness to choose to elevate the conversation.

This year’s Civic Discourse Week theme is “Identity with Intention” featuring interactive discussions and activities focused on particular topics, including the LGBTQ+ community, underrepresented and marginalized identities, diversity, inclusion, equity matters, and raising awareness on combating all sexual violence.
